Abstract :
This study aims at rapid BMI pattern recognition for the eye-ball movement, which is considered to be removed factor from EEG as artifact. We investigated the repeatability of eyeball movement ERP and the characteristics, which possess steady, high voltage and 50ms rapid reaction. As ERP pattern discriminator, this paper proposes 3 methods to extract and distinguish characteristic patterns induced by several directional ocular movements.
